The Mid-Essex Football League is an amateur football league based in Essex, England. The league was founded in 1909 and currently has five divisions, with the top division being the Premier Division.

The league is affiliated to the Essex County Football Association and is a feeder league to the Essex Olympian Football League. The winners of the Premier Division are promoted to the Essex Olympian Football League Division Two, while the bottom two teams are relegated to Division One.

The Mid-Essex Football League was founded in 1909 by a group of local football clubs. The original league had just two divisions, but this has since expanded to five divisions.
